WILD RICE AND OYSTER CASSEROLE
A rich oyster dish that makes a perfect Thanksgiving side dish.
Provided by D. Reynolds
Categories Side Dish
Yield 11
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- In a large saucepan place the rice, consomme and water. Bring to a boil and boil for 5 minutes. Cover, reduce heat to low and simmer until rice is tender, about 20 minutes. Stir in butter.
-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
- Place half of rice in large baking dish. Cover with oysters seasoned with salt, pepper, and hot sauce to taste. Top with remaining rice.
- Heat mushroom soup, half and half, onion powder, thyme, and curry powder. Pour over rice and oyster mixture.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 45 minutes. Garnish with parsley.

DAD'S OYSTER DRESSING
What holiday dinner would be complete without Dad's dressing packed with wild rice and oysters?
Provided by S Campbell
Categories Side Dish Stuffing and Dressing Recipes Sausage Stuffing and Dressing Recipes
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Open and quarter the oysters. Reserve the liquid.
- Cook rice in boiling salted water till tender, about 40 minutes. Drain, and place in shallow pan. Place pan in a 275 degree F(135 degree C) oven to dry out for a few minutes.
- Saute pork in skillet over medium heat. Remove pork from pan using a slotted spoon. Drain off all but a couple of tablespoons grease.
- Saute onions and celery. Add into this a small amount of oyster liqueur if onions and celery get too dry. Add in oysters with remaining liqueur. Cook 7 - 10 minutes, until oysters curl on edges. Drain this mixture in a colander.
- Combine oyster mixture, rice, sausage, chopped parsley, and seasonings to taste.
-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) till heated through.

OYSTER-AND-RICE DRESSING
Provided by Craig Claiborne
Categories casseroles, side dish
Time 1h
Yield 12 servings
Number Of Ingredients 19
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
- Combine 3 1/2 cups of the broth and the rice in a saucepan and bring to the boil. Cover closely and cook 17 to 20 minutes or until the rice is tender. Remove from the heat and let stand covered until ready to use.
- Meanwhile, prepare the chopped vegetables and bread crumbs.
- Heat the margarine in a skillet and add half the chopped onion, celery and green pepper. Cook, stirring, until the onions start to brown lightly. Add the butter, garlic and remaining chopped onion, green pepper and celery. Cook until the second batch of onion is wilted. Add the scallions and parsley. Remove from the heat and add the remaining chicken broth, beaten eggs, oysters, oyster liquor, thyme, oregano, salt, pepper and cayenne. Blend well.
- Pour and scrape the mixture into a deep skillet and sprinkle evenly with bread crumbs. Bake 30 to 40 minutes or until piping hot throughout.

EGGPLANT AND OYSTER RICE DRESSING
Categories Rice Side Bake Thanksgiving Oyster Eggplant Fall Gourmet Sugar Conscious Kidney Friendly Pescatarian Dairy Free Wheat/Gluten-Free Peanut Free Tree Nut Free Soy Free No Sugar Added
Yield Makes about 8 cups
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Bring water and salt to a boil in a 3-quart saucepan. Add rice and cook, covered, over low heat until water is absorbed and rice is just cooked through, 18 to 20 minutes. Transfer to a large bowl and fluff with a fork.
- Heat 2 tablespoons oil in a large heavy skillet over moderately high heat until hot but not smoking, then cook eggplant in batches, turning it and adding up to 4 tablespoons of remaining oil as necessary, until tender and browned, about 5 minutes. Transfer to paper towels to drain. When cool enough to handle, cut eggplant into 1/2-inch pieces.
- Preheat oven to 325°F.
- Heat remaining oil in skillet over moderately high heat until hot but not smoking, then sauté onion and bell pepper, stirring, until softened and edges are browned. Add garlic, oysters (without liquor), and eggplant and sauté, stirring occasionally, 1 minute.
- Gently toss eggplant mixture, oyster liquor, 1/2 cup scallions, cayenne, and salt to taste with rice in bowl and transfer to a buttered 3-quart shallow baking dish. Cover with foil and bake in middle of oven 1 1/2 hours. Remove foil and stir in remaining 1/2 cup scallions.

- Oysters are funny old things. Now they’re considered a decadent aphrodisiac, when only 100 years ago they were the pigeons of the sea and would be chucked into pies as peasant food.
- Aphrodisiac? I’m not sure, but I do seem to have acquired a taste for them over the last 3 years.I’ve eaten oysters all round the world and everyone seems to think that theirs are the best – well, I’ll join the patriotic club and say that the best oysters I’ve ever eaten in my life are West Mersea Essex native oysters, sometimes known as Colchester oysters, along with some West Irish oysters that have a beautiful iron and subtle seawatery taste.
- The oysters directly from West Mersea are fantastic because they are farmed a couple of miles down the estuary where Maldon sea salt comes from.
- The nutrients from the marshland are leached out when the rain falls on it and are later drained into the estuary, so it’s a fantastically nutritious area.
